Reproducibility of Subfoveal Choroidal Thickness Measurements with Enhanced Depth Imaging By Spectral-Domain Optical Coherence Tomography
Purpose: To measure the interobserver reproducibility and intraobserver reproducibility of subfoveal choroidal thickness measurements performed by enhanced depth imaging of spectral-domain optical coherence tomography (EDI-OCT) in a population-based setting. Method: The Beijing Eye Study 2011 was a population-based study performed in rural and urban regions of Greater Beijing. The study included 3468 individuals with a mean age of 64.6±9.8 years (range: 50-93 years). The participants underwent EDI-OCT and the subfoveal choroidal thickness (SFCT) was measured.
